chore(deps): update terraform aws to v6.27.0 #80

Merged
renovate-bot merged 1 commit from renovate/aws-6.x into main 2025-12-18 01:03:53 +00:00
Member

This PR contains the following updates:

Package Type Update Change
aws (source) required_provider minor 6.26.0 -> 6.27.0

Release Notes

hashicorp/terraform-provider-aws (aws)

v6.27.0

Compare Source

FEATURES:

  • New Data Source: aws_organizations_account (#​45543)
  • New Function: user_agent (#​45464)
  • New List Resource: aws_kms_key (#​45514)
  • New Resource: aws_cloudfront_trust_store (#​45534)

ENHANCEMENTS:

  • data-source/aws_datazone_domain: Add root_domain_unit_id attribute (#​44964)
  • data-source/aws_networkmanager_core_network_policy_document: Add routing_policies and attachment_routing_policy_rules arguments (#​45246)
  • data-source/aws_route53_resolver_endpoint: Add rni_enhanced_metrics_enabled attribute (#​45630)
  • data-source/aws_route53_resolver_endpoint: Add target_name_server_metrics_enabled attribute (#​45630)
  • provider: Add user_agent argument (#​45464)
  • provider: The provider_meta block is now supported. The user_agent argument enables module authors to include additional product information in the User-Agent header sent during all AWS API requests made during Create, Read, Update, and Delete operations. (#​45464)
  • resource/aws_bedrockagent_knowledge_base: Add knowledge_base_configuration.kendra_knowledge_base_configuration argument (#​44388)
  • resource/aws_bedrockagent_knowledge_base: Add knowledge_base_configuration.sql_knowledge_base_configuration and storage_configuration.neptune_analytics_configuration arguments (#​45465)
  • resource/aws_bedrockagent_knowledge_base: Add storage_configuration.mongo_db_atlas_configuration argument (#​37220)
  • resource/aws_bedrockagent_knowledge_base: Add storage_configuration.opensearch_managed_cluster_configuration argument (#​44060)
  • resource/aws_bedrockagent_knowledge_base: Add storage_configuration.s3_vectors_configuration block (#​45468)
  • resource/aws_bedrockagent_knowledge_base: Make knowledge_base_configuration.vector_knowledge_base_configuration and ``storage_configuration` optional (#​44388)
  • resource/aws_codebuild_project: Add cache.cache_namespace argument (#​45584)
  • resource/aws_datazone_domain: Add root_domain_unit_id argument (#​44964)
  • resource/aws_lambda_function: code_sha256 is now optional and computed (#​45618)
  • resource/aws_networkmanager_connect_attachment: Add routing_policy_label argument (#​45246)
  • resource/aws_networkmanager_connect_peer: Support 4 byte ASNs in bgp_options.peer_asn (#​45246)
  • resource/aws_networkmanager_connect_peer: Support 4 byte ASNs in configuration.bgp_configurations.peer_asn (#​45639)
  • resource/aws_networkmanager_dx_gateway_attachment: Add routing_policy_label argument (#​45246)
  • resource/aws_networkmanager_site_to_site_vpn_attachment: Add routing_policy_label argument (#​45246)
  • resource/aws_networkmanager_transit_gateway_route_table_attachment: Add routing_policy_label argument (#​45246)
  • resource/aws_networkmanager_vpc_attachment: Add routing_policy_label argument (#​45246)
  • resource/aws_route53_resolver_endpoint: Add rni_enhanced_metrics_enabled argument (#​45630)
  • resource/aws_route53_resolver_endpoint: Add target_name_server_metrics_enabled argument (#​45630)
  • resource/aws_vpclattice_service_network_vpc_association: Add private_dns_enabled and dns_options arguments (#​45619)

BUG FIXES:

  • data-source/aws_networkmanager_core_network_policy_document: Correct plan-time validation of attachment_policies.conditions.type to allow account instead of account-id (#​45246)
  • resource/aws_bedrockagent_knowledge_base: Mark knowledge_base_configuration.vector_knowledge_base_configuration.embedding_model_configuration and knowledge_base_configuration.vector_knowledge_base_configuration.supplemental_data_storage_configuration as ForceNew (#​45465)
  • resource/aws_dynamodb_table: Fix perpetual diff on global_secondary_index when using ignore_changes lifecycle meta-argument (#​41113)
  • resource/aws_iam_user: Fix NoSuchEntity errors when name and tags arguments are both updated (#​45608)
  • resource/aws_lakeformation_data_cells_filter: Fix excluded_column_names ordering causing "Provider produced inconsistent result after apply" errors (#​45453)
  • resource/aws_neptune_global_cluster: Fix a regression in the minor version upgrade workflow triggered by upstream changes to the API error response text (#​45605)
  • resource/aws_networkmanager_connect_peer: Change bgp_options and bgp_options.peer_asn to Optional, Computed and ForceNew (#​45639)
  • resource/aws_odb_cloud_vm_cluster: Enable deletion of vm cluster in resource shared account. (#​45552)
  • resource/aws_rds_global_cluster: Fix a regression in the minor version upgrade workflow triggered by upstream changes to the API error response text (#​45605)
  • resource/aws_s3_bucket: Fix endpoint rule error, AccountId must only contain a-z, A-Z, 0-9 and `-`​ errors when the provider is configured with skip_requesting_account_id = true. This fixes a regression introduced in v6.23.0 (#​45576)
  • resource/aws_verifiedpermissions_identity_source: Fixes error when updating resource (#​45540)
  • resource/aws_verifiedpermissions_identity_source: Prevents eventual consistency error with associated Policy Store (#​45540)
  • resource/aws_verifiedpermissions_identity_source: Removes AutoFlex error log messages (#​45540)

Configuration

📅 Schedule: Branch creation - At any time (no schedule defined), Automerge - At any time (no schedule defined).

🚦 Automerge: Enabled.

Rebasing: Whenever PR is behind base branch, or you tick the rebase/retry checkbox.

🔕 Ignore: Close this PR and you won't be reminded about this update again.


  • If you want to rebase/retry this PR, check this box

This PR has been generated by Renovate Bot.

This PR contains the following updates: | Package | Type | Update | Change | |---|---|---|---| | [aws](https://registry.terraform.io/providers/hashicorp/aws) ([source](https://github.com/hashicorp/terraform-provider-aws)) | required_provider | minor | `6.26.0` -> `6.27.0` | --- ### Release Notes <details> <summary>hashicorp/terraform-provider-aws (aws)</summary> ### [`v6.27.0`](https://github.com/hashicorp/terraform-provider-aws/blob/HEAD/CHANGELOG.md#6270-December-17-2025) [Compare Source](https://github.com/hashicorp/terraform-provider-aws/compare/v6.26.0...v6.27.0) FEATURES: - **New Data Source:** `aws_organizations_account` ([#&#8203;45543](https://github.com/hashicorp/terraform-provider-aws/issues/45543)) - **New Function:** `user_agent` ([#&#8203;45464](https://github.com/hashicorp/terraform-provider-aws/issues/45464)) - **New List Resource:** `aws_kms_key` ([#&#8203;45514](https://github.com/hashicorp/terraform-provider-aws/issues/45514)) - **New Resource:** `aws_cloudfront_trust_store` ([#&#8203;45534](https://github.com/hashicorp/terraform-provider-aws/issues/45534)) ENHANCEMENTS: - data-source/aws\_datazone\_domain: Add `root_domain_unit_id` attribute ([#&#8203;44964](https://github.com/hashicorp/terraform-provider-aws/issues/44964)) - data-source/aws\_networkmanager\_core\_network\_policy\_document: Add `routing_policies` and `attachment_routing_policy_rules` arguments ([#&#8203;45246](https://github.com/hashicorp/terraform-provider-aws/issues/45246)) - data-source/aws\_route53\_resolver\_endpoint: Add `rni_enhanced_metrics_enabled` attribute ([#&#8203;45630](https://github.com/hashicorp/terraform-provider-aws/issues/45630)) - data-source/aws\_route53\_resolver\_endpoint: Add `target_name_server_metrics_enabled` attribute ([#&#8203;45630](https://github.com/hashicorp/terraform-provider-aws/issues/45630)) - provider: Add `user_agent` argument ([#&#8203;45464](https://github.com/hashicorp/terraform-provider-aws/issues/45464)) - provider: The [`provider_meta` block](https://developer.hashicorp.com/terraform/internals/provider-meta) is now supported. The `user_agent` argument enables module authors to include additional product information in the `User-Agent` header sent during all AWS API requests made during Create, Read, Update, and Delete operations. ([#&#8203;45464](https://github.com/hashicorp/terraform-provider-aws/issues/45464)) - resource/aws\_bedrockagent\_knowledge\_base: Add `knowledge_base_configuration.kendra_knowledge_base_configuration` argument ([#&#8203;44388](https://github.com/hashicorp/terraform-provider-aws/issues/44388)) - resource/aws\_bedrockagent\_knowledge\_base: Add `knowledge_base_configuration.sql_knowledge_base_configuration` and `storage_configuration.neptune_analytics_configuration` arguments ([#&#8203;45465](https://github.com/hashicorp/terraform-provider-aws/issues/45465)) - resource/aws\_bedrockagent\_knowledge\_base: Add `storage_configuration.mongo_db_atlas_configuration` argument ([#&#8203;37220](https://github.com/hashicorp/terraform-provider-aws/issues/37220)) - resource/aws\_bedrockagent\_knowledge\_base: Add `storage_configuration.opensearch_managed_cluster_configuration` argument ([#&#8203;44060](https://github.com/hashicorp/terraform-provider-aws/issues/44060)) - resource/aws\_bedrockagent\_knowledge\_base: Add `storage_configuration.s3_vectors_configuration` block ([#&#8203;45468](https://github.com/hashicorp/terraform-provider-aws/issues/45468)) - resource/aws\_bedrockagent\_knowledge\_base: Make `knowledge_base_configuration.vector_knowledge_base_configuration` and \`\`storage\_configuration\` optional ([#&#8203;44388](https://github.com/hashicorp/terraform-provider-aws/issues/44388)) - resource/aws\_codebuild\_project: Add `cache.cache_namespace` argument ([#&#8203;45584](https://github.com/hashicorp/terraform-provider-aws/issues/45584)) - resource/aws\_datazone\_domain: Add `root_domain_unit_id` argument ([#&#8203;44964](https://github.com/hashicorp/terraform-provider-aws/issues/44964)) - resource/aws\_lambda\_function: `code_sha256` is now optional and computed ([#&#8203;45618](https://github.com/hashicorp/terraform-provider-aws/issues/45618)) - resource/aws\_networkmanager\_connect\_attachment: Add `routing_policy_label` argument ([#&#8203;45246](https://github.com/hashicorp/terraform-provider-aws/issues/45246)) - resource/aws\_networkmanager\_connect\_peer: Support 4 byte ASNs in `bgp_options.peer_asn` ([#&#8203;45246](https://github.com/hashicorp/terraform-provider-aws/issues/45246)) - resource/aws\_networkmanager\_connect\_peer: Support 4 byte ASNs in `configuration.bgp_configurations.peer_asn` ([#&#8203;45639](https://github.com/hashicorp/terraform-provider-aws/issues/45639)) - resource/aws\_networkmanager\_dx\_gateway\_attachment: Add `routing_policy_label` argument ([#&#8203;45246](https://github.com/hashicorp/terraform-provider-aws/issues/45246)) - resource/aws\_networkmanager\_site\_to\_site\_vpn\_attachment: Add `routing_policy_label` argument ([#&#8203;45246](https://github.com/hashicorp/terraform-provider-aws/issues/45246)) - resource/aws\_networkmanager\_transit\_gateway\_route\_table\_attachment: Add `routing_policy_label` argument ([#&#8203;45246](https://github.com/hashicorp/terraform-provider-aws/issues/45246)) - resource/aws\_networkmanager\_vpc\_attachment: Add `routing_policy_label` argument ([#&#8203;45246](https://github.com/hashicorp/terraform-provider-aws/issues/45246)) - resource/aws\_route53\_resolver\_endpoint: Add `rni_enhanced_metrics_enabled` argument ([#&#8203;45630](https://github.com/hashicorp/terraform-provider-aws/issues/45630)) - resource/aws\_route53\_resolver\_endpoint: Add `target_name_server_metrics_enabled` argument ([#&#8203;45630](https://github.com/hashicorp/terraform-provider-aws/issues/45630)) - resource/aws\_vpclattice\_service\_network\_vpc\_association: Add `private_dns_enabled` and `dns_options` arguments ([#&#8203;45619](https://github.com/hashicorp/terraform-provider-aws/issues/45619)) BUG FIXES: - data-source/aws\_networkmanager\_core\_network\_policy\_document: Correct plan-time validation of `attachment_policies.conditions.type` to allow `account` instead of `account-id` ([#&#8203;45246](https://github.com/hashicorp/terraform-provider-aws/issues/45246)) - resource/aws\_bedrockagent\_knowledge\_base: Mark `knowledge_base_configuration.vector_knowledge_base_configuration.embedding_model_configuration` and `knowledge_base_configuration.vector_knowledge_base_configuration.supplemental_data_storage_configuration` as `ForceNew` ([#&#8203;45465](https://github.com/hashicorp/terraform-provider-aws/issues/45465)) - resource/aws\_dynamodb\_table: Fix perpetual diff on `global_secondary_index` when using `ignore_changes` lifecycle meta-argument ([#&#8203;41113](https://github.com/hashicorp/terraform-provider-aws/issues/41113)) - resource/aws\_iam\_user: Fix `NoSuchEntity` errors when `name` and `tags` arguments are both updated ([#&#8203;45608](https://github.com/hashicorp/terraform-provider-aws/issues/45608)) - resource/aws\_lakeformation\_data\_cells\_filter: Fix `excluded_column_names` ordering causing "Provider produced inconsistent result after apply" errors ([#&#8203;45453](https://github.com/hashicorp/terraform-provider-aws/issues/45453)) - resource/aws\_neptune\_global\_cluster: Fix a regression in the minor version upgrade workflow triggered by upstream changes to the API error response text ([#&#8203;45605](https://github.com/hashicorp/terraform-provider-aws/issues/45605)) - resource/aws\_networkmanager\_connect\_peer: Change `bgp_options` and `bgp_options.peer_asn` to Optional, Computed and ForceNew ([#&#8203;45639](https://github.com/hashicorp/terraform-provider-aws/issues/45639)) - resource/aws\_odb\_cloud\_vm\_cluster: Enable deletion of vm cluster in resource shared account. ([#&#8203;45552](https://github.com/hashicorp/terraform-provider-aws/issues/45552)) - resource/aws\_rds\_global\_cluster: Fix a regression in the minor version upgrade workflow triggered by upstream changes to the API error response text ([#&#8203;45605](https://github.com/hashicorp/terraform-provider-aws/issues/45605)) - resource/aws\_s3\_bucket: Fix ``endpoint rule error, AccountId must only contain a-z, A-Z, 0-9 and `-`​`` errors when the provider is configured with [`skip_requesting_account_id = true`](https://registry.terraform.io/providers/hashicorp/aws/latest/docs#skip_requesting_account_id-1). This fixes a regression introduced in [v6.23.0](https://github.com/hashicorp/terraform-provider-aws/blob/main/CHANGELOG.md#6230-november-26-2025) ([#&#8203;45576](https://github.com/hashicorp/terraform-provider-aws/issues/45576)) - resource/aws\_verifiedpermissions\_identity\_source: Fixes error when updating resource ([#&#8203;45540](https://github.com/hashicorp/terraform-provider-aws/issues/45540)) - resource/aws\_verifiedpermissions\_identity\_source: Prevents eventual consistency error with associated Policy Store ([#&#8203;45540](https://github.com/hashicorp/terraform-provider-aws/issues/45540)) - resource/aws\_verifiedpermissions\_identity\_source: Removes AutoFlex error log messages ([#&#8203;45540](https://github.com/hashicorp/terraform-provider-aws/issues/45540)) </details> --- ### Configuration 📅 **Schedule**: Branch creation - At any time (no schedule defined), Automerge - At any time (no schedule defined). 🚦 **Automerge**: Enabled. ♻ **Rebasing**: Whenever PR is behind base branch, or you tick the rebase/retry checkbox. 🔕 **Ignore**: Close this PR and you won't be reminded about this update again. --- - [ ] <!-- rebase-check -->If you want to rebase/retry this PR, check this box --- This PR has been generated by [Renovate Bot](https://github.com/renovatebot/renovate). <!--renovate-debug:eyJjcmVhdGVkSW5WZXIiOiI0Mi41OS4xIiwidXBkYXRlZEluVmVyIjoiNDIuNTkuMSIsInRhcmdldEJyYW5jaCI6Im1haW4iLCJsYWJlbHMiOltdfQ==-->
renovate-bot scheduled this pull request to auto merge when all checks succeed 2025-12-18 01:03:52 +00:00
Commenting is not possible because the repository is archived.
No reviewers
No labels
No milestone
No project
No assignees
1 participant
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ference
infrastructure/tf-template!80
No description provided.